Swapped thermal paste from the cheap stuff to MX-4 and my CPU temps dropped 12C
Been building PCs for about 5 years now and always just used whatever thermal paste came with the cooler or the cheapest tube on Amazon. Last month I rebuilt my Ryzen 5 3600 rig and decided to try Arctic MX-4 since it was like 8 bucks for a bigger tube. I cleaned off the old paste with isopropyl and did my usual pea-sized dab in the middle. Booted up and my idle temps went from 45C to 33C and under load it dropped from 78C to 66C. That's a huge difference for just a few bucks more. I always thought thermal paste was thermal paste but clearly not. Has anyone else seen big gains from switching brands or did I just have bad application before?
